Head to head by decade
| Decade | Afghanistan | Somalia |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1970s | 3.4% | 23.7% | 20.3% | Somalia |
| 1980s | 0.6% | 6.7% | 6.1% | Somalia |
| 2000s | 0.3% | 0.0% | 0.3% | Afghanistan |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
